Output 59577f7a3948f4d2c42610a526cf2f0600a19c240203092981f8a6135491759b:51

value
12504732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 132b27cf88259565ad6e1eed25054d3eb853e5b2 OP_EQUAL
address
M9eWma9oQWTKddKQd7hDYM8WQRNn9SBL9u
transaction
59577f7a3948f4d2c42610a526cf2f0600a19c240203092981f8a6135491759b
spent
true